Seminar on e-office held
16:38', 12/2/ 2009 (GMT+7)

The Department of Information and Communications and Nguyen Hoang Tech Development and Investment JSC held a seminar on e-office in Quy Nhon city on Feb. 11.

Over 150 representatives of the province’s agencies and businesses attended the seminar.

At the seminar, participants knew more about the operation of e-office and mobile office in which all procedures are carried out via Internet or short message service (SMS).

E-office solutions are expected to help agencies and businesses save time in administrative procedures and improve the effectiveness of paperwork.
